Transaction

dd4d66dfb84a41afdf7bb047f450af01c817df99f64e22cd8e6b6c11fef4b0cd
279,309 confirmations
Timestamp
1606734018
Block659,342
Fee274,041 sats
Fee rate53.4 sats/vB
view on mempool.space

Inputs & Outputs

Inputs